Novel Bifunctional Single-Chain Variable Antibody Fragments to Enhance Virolysis by Complement: Generation and Proof-of-Concept

Figure 8

In silico analysis of binding 48scFv to envelope-protein of F-MuLV. (a) LC-Fv (purple) and HC-Fv (yellow) of 48scFv are connected by a (G4S)3-linker (green). (b) F-MuLV-gp70 (grey, data from pdb: 1AOL) and the main binding pocket (red) to its cellular receptor. (c) Docking calculation of 48scFv and gp70. Two SCR1920-models (light blue) were superimposed to the C-terminus of 48scFv illustrating the flexibility of the GS-linker (green) and the probable covering area (arrows). 3D-modelling of 48scFv (a) and SCR1920 ((c), light blue) was performed using I-TASSER [15]. Docking calculation of 48scFv and F-MuLV-gp70 was performed by ZDOCK [16].
